Stejo & Jason vs The Wicked Clowns
Tag Team match
This match went down great and Stejo got some huge pops at the start, through and in the end. The Wicked Clowns used a smart strategy in this match, though, once they had Jason in they kept him away from Stejo, picking him apart, bit by bit. But Jason finally got the tag, however the referee was distracted by Hatchet and missed it, forcing Stejo to stay in the corner while the Wicked Clowns continued the assault on Jason. Finally, once it looked bad for Stejo and Jason, the new kid got the tag and Stejo finally got his shot. He planted both Wicked Clowns with a Burnout and then hit an AMAZING Frogsplash on both guys to pick up the win. He got a huge cheer after the match and had a good celebration with Jason.

Raze vs D-Dawg
Ladder match
X Division Championship
The match sunk in pretty fast, with D-Dawg and Raze showing great signs of determination. The ladders were used to mainly Raze's advantage as he lay them on D-Dawg twice, landing two Rolling Thunders on D-Dawg. If this wasn't enough brutality the ladders where then set up like a table which Raze hit an amazing Bulldog on D-Dawg with, jumping right over it but landing D-Dawg right on top of it. After getting really cocky with the ladder abuse he set the ladders up like a table again and went for a spear on D-Dawg but after waiting to long to charge at the challenger, he was Back Bodydropped right onto the ladders, leaving him motionless for a few seconds. D-Dawg then grabbed hold of a Spanner from the side and waited for Raze to get up but as he went to nail Raze with the Spanner, the champion ducked and D-Dawg nailed the referee but he didn't stop to worry as he turned and caught Raze in a Death Valley Driver and then went straight for the title. He managed to retrieve the title but as he decended the ladder he was met by Hostile who nailed him with a brutal shot to the head and then gave the title to Raze who staggered to his feet and got the referee up to notice him with the title and declare him the winner. Raze then gave a quick interview saying that anyone else wanting a shot at the title can expect the same fate.

James Tough vs Hostile
Weapon of Choice match
Weapons: Hostile - Steel Chain ; James Toguh - Steel Pole
Hardcore Championship
If it wasn't enough that they had the Pole and Chain as their choice of weapon, James and Hostile took it to the extremes when they involved tables, ladders, light tubes, rocks, shutters, railings and rope. After James landed on Hostile with flip off the ladders and Hostile underneath another set of ladders, both guys started feeling the intensity of such a match. James recovered before Hostile and started battering away at his knee with some kicks, the ladders and his steel pole. Hostile suffered a serious knee injury throughout the rest of the match but it didn't stop him. He went straight for a light tube after recovering enough that he could stand and smashed it over James' back numerous times. He then took it onto the concrete where he smashed James' head against a metal railing and battered him against a shutter a few times. He then started hammering into his head with a rock before the action got back to the ring area. If James wasn't already feeling the pressure enough, Hostile Suplexed him from a ladder right through a table which litterally broke him in half, as did it the table. To try and win the match Hostile then grabbed some rope which he got from the crowd and tied it around James' neck to try and choke him out. But it wasn't enough to put away James Tough. The Champion managed to knocked Hostile onto the ground and then slowly got to his feet, using the ladder for leverage. He then got hold of the rope that Hostile was using and whipped him over the side with it, making a huge sound when it connected with Hostile. He then German Suplexed Hostile through the remains of the table and then looked like he was ready to win. But as he went to closeline Hostile he was caught in the Crossface and instead of applying it properly, Hostile got out his steel chain and choked James out, to win the match and become Hardcore Champion! He was then met by Vitamin C who offered a handshake but instead of shaking hands, Vitamin C smashed half a light tube over Hostile's head and then executed the Overdose on him right on top of a ladder.
Shortkut vs Bison Fury
20 Minute Ultimate Submission match
Once both guys were out, they arranged an arm wrestling contest to take place. After trying twice to cheat and then losing, Shortkut slapped Bison over the head. He then took a quick advantage and before long got the first fall after making Bison tap out to the Ankle Lock. Bison came back quickly though with an Armbar, forcing Shortkut to tap out. From there, though, both guys started using some big moves to try and weaken the opponent as they knew it wouldn't get any easier. So after both guys were feeling the pressure, Shortkut managed to sneak in with his Short-Circuit and force bison to tap, lifting his score to 2-1. Shortkut then set up the tallestladder and got Bison in position. He then climbed the ladder, looking asif he was going to execute a high-flying move. But as he was climbing the ladder (with his back to Bison), Fury got to his feet and pushed the ladder over, sideways, sending Shortkut crashing through the Arm-wrestling table. From there Bison went on to lock Shortkut in a very painful-looking hold which forced the eagar Shortkut to tap again, making it an even 2-2. With the remains of the table Bison got Shortkut and sent him through it with an Overdose shouting, "This one's for VC!". Finally the last minute of the match came it Shortkut looked to have it won, but Bison managed to escape the hold and get Shortkut locked in Sharpshooter with 20 seconds remaining. And in the last 3 seconds Shortkut tapped! Bison then had a huge celebration with all his friends and the Dominant Force attended to Shortkut. Bison then offered his hand to Shortkut and surprisingly the Force leader accepted and they shook hands.
Ludicrous vs Rambo
Best 2 out of 3 Falls match
1st Fall: Singlee match - 2nd Fall: Table match - 3rd Fall: Street Fight
UWF Championship
To start things off, Dominant Force all came out together. Shortkut said that Rambo has been crownd as the new Champion since Ludicrous has not shown up for his match. They then held Rambo up, over their shoulders to celebrate Rambo as the new Champion. But before they could continue, Ludicrous' music hit and he charged in from behind a large building. He threw down his belongings and charged at the Dominant Force, taking them apart until it came down to just him and Rambo. It started of pretty easy going. Rambo had a couple of good oppertunities to get the pin but he missed them and was even knocked off the Champ after an attempted RKO. But the first fall came when Rambo faked a serious injury and lay motionless while Ludicrous looked on in confusion. After thinking aobut what had happened, Ludicrous covered Rambo to go for the 3 count but what he didn't realise is that Rambo was faking the whole thing and reversed the pin into a quick roll-up of his own to steal the first fall. From there, though, Ludicrous made sure Rambo wouldn't try anything else like that and really took it to the challenger. He hit him with some seriously effective manouveurs and it looked like it might be over for the hopeful Rambo. One move which really looked devastating was a thunderous Brainbuster by Ludicrous which had Rambo land right on his neck. Ludicrous then had the table set up and it didn't look clear as to which guy was going to go through as each guy would reverse the others attempts. Finally Ludicrous lifted Rambo high into the air and spun him round, 360, and planted him through the table with a sickening Spinebuster. So the score was evened at 1-1 with the finally fall to be decided. It seemed like it could go either way in the final one with both guys giving it all they had and this was backed up by what they went through but still managed to survive. We saw Rambo kick out of the Suicide DDT, the first time that has happened in recent history. We also saw Rambo survive a Brainbuster through the table's remains, Rambo being thrown through the piled ladders and table remains and Ludicrous Piledriving Rambo from the ladders. After all this it seemed like it was definetely over for Rambo but Ludicrous set up the ladders, hoping to pull off something amazing to end the match but Rambo somehow grabbed hold of Ludicrous and executed the RKO right from the top of the ladders and became UWF Champion with a 3 count pinfall. He was then greeted by Raze and Hostile who celebrated with him as the show came to an end!
